      DETROIT (AP) - Scott Baker had a strong start and got plenty of
run support with a three-run third inning and a four-run eighth,
helping the Twins beat the Detroit Tigers 8-3 Thursday to avoid
elimination from playoff contention.
      The AL Central-leading Tigers had a chance to clinch their first
division title since 1987 in the finale of the four-game series,
but their bats were quieted and their pitchers got roughed up.
      The tightest race in baseball won't be decided until this
weekend - or early next week if a tiebreaker is necessary.
      If Detroit beats the Chicago White Sox twice at home, it will
win the division. If not, the Tigers will need some help from the
Kansas City Royals, who end the season at Minnesota.
